How Emerging Technologies Will Influence the Evolution of NFTs and Crypto

The world of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) and cryptocurrency is constantly evolving, with new technologies shaping the landscape. Emerging technologies will play a crucial role in influencing the future of NFTs and crypto, impacting everything from the way assets are tokenized to how they are bought, sold, and stored. Let’s explore how these emerging technologies will shape the evolution of NFTs and crypto.

One of the key technologies that will impact the world of NFTs and crypto is blockchain. Blockchain technology has been instrumental in the rise of NFTs, offering a secure and transparent way to verify ownership and authenticity. As blockchain technologies continue to evolve, we can expect to see improvements in scalability, interoperability, and sustainability, which will in turn benefit the NFT ecosystem.

Another technology that will influence the evolution of NFTs and crypto is artificial intelligence (AI). AI can be used to analyze trends in the market, predict demand for certain types of NFTs, and even generate unique digital assets. As AI becomes more sophisticated, we may see new ways of creating and trading NFTs emerge, making the space even more dynamic and diverse.

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are also poised to revolutionize the NFT and crypto markets. By enabling users to experience digital assets in immersive 3D environments, VR and AR can enhance the value and utility of NFTs. Imagine being able to walk through a virtual gallery showcasing your NFT collection, or attending a concert in a virtual world where the tickets are NFTs. The possibilities are endless.
